Thielemann & Vienna Philharmonic Bruckner Bicentennial Project "Bruckner 11/Bruckner 11" recorded at the Musikverein Vienna in 2019 No. 2 & No. 8The project by Thielemann & the Vienna Philharmonic for Bruckner's bicentennial in 2024, " Bruckner 11", a project by Thielemann & Vienna Philharmonic for the bicentennial anniversary of Bruckner's birth in 2024, is a collection of Bruckner's symphonies in C major, the first volume of which includes the 5th Symphony and the "Study Symphonies" WAB99 in F minor and WAB100 in D minor, which were performed and recorded for the first time in the history of the Vienna Philharmonic, and the second volume of which features the Vienna manuscripts of the 1st and 8th symphonies, which were performed and recorded in 2021. The second concert was a combination of No. 1 using the Vienna manuscript and No. 7 recorded live at the Salzburg Festival in August 2021. This time, the second and eighth videos, recorded at the Musikverein in Vienna in February 2019, will be released.After the "Symphony No. 1" in C minor (first draft), completed in 1866 and premiered in 1868, Bruckner composed the "D minor" symphony in 1869. He originally intended to call this work "Symphony No. 2," but in the end this work was never given a number, and it is now called "Symphony No. 0," WAB.100. Bruckner then began work on his "Second Symphony," which was completed in September 1972 and premiered by the Vienna Philharmonic Orchestra in 1973 under the composer's own baton.However, it was later substantially modified and performed again in February 1876 (this is the second draft). In an interview with Thielemann in the bonus video, he says of performing the Second and early symphonies, "Bruckner's early symphonies are a group of works that deserve more attention. Bruckner's early symphonies deserve more attention. But they also present a great challenge to conductors, which is one of the reasons why they are avoided. The reason is that these early symphonies are simply boring and tedious to play unless they are studied in detail. Moreover, these early symphonies do not offer salvation from the start. On the other hand, Thielemann says that "Symphony No. 8" is the pinnacle of the symphony, and that the Haas version is perfect. Thielemann has performed Bruckner's Eighth Symphony in many of his symphonies, choosing the Haas version with the Vienna Philharmonic in 2007, the Novák version with the Berlin Philharmonic in 2008, and the Haas version with the Staatskapelle Dresden in 2009. Thielemann discusses the reasons for choosing the Haas edition here, as well as the editions used by other historical conductors, in an interview.
